“When I was 19, I was working in a coffee shop that stayed open late on weekends. The shop was surrounded by bars and there was this one customer who would come in about every other week and harass me. The general manager, who was never in at night and thus never witnessed it, wouldn’t let us trespass the guy, so the supervisors and the rest of the night crew banded together to protect me from him.”

“If anyone asked me to ‘go get some caramel’ after 8 p.m., it was code for ‘your stalker is coming, go hide.’ I was always behind the espresso machine so I wouldn’t be visible from outside or from the entryway and my colleagues always saw him before he saw me. 

Security for a nearby parking structure even started picking me up after my shift in their golf cart to drive me to my car so I couldn’t be followed. Between this team of like 20 people working together to keep me safe, they eventually managed to convince the guy that I had quit and he stopped coming around.”
